Four months after his death, AJ Perez’s memory is kept alive by the Eye Bank Foundation of the Philippines that recently named him its newest poster boy.The 18-year-old actor’s father, Gerry Perez, and younger brother, Angelo, graced the Eye Bank event, as reported on “TV Patrol,” Aug. 24. Clips also showed AJ’s good friends and fellow “Sabel” cast members Jessy Mendiola and Joseph Marco at the occasion.Angelo seemed to have followed in his brother’s footsteps by signing up to be a cornea donor.“I would love to donate and... I would really be proud of myself and I want to be just like my brother,” said he in an interview with the news program.The Perez family has donated AJ’s corneas to the Eye Bank, which benefited eight-year-old Daniel delos Santos and 28-year-old Lawrence Villanueva, who were both at the event as well.The two recipients underwent their respective corneal transplants on separate dates shortly after AJ’s death last April.“Guminhawa na po ‘yung pakiramdam ko,” was Daniel’s declaration to “TV Patrol.”Lawrence is as grateful to have received AJ’s cornea. He said that it relieved him of a problem with his left eye, which had previously affected his performance at work.“Two months pa lang ‘yung healing process niya and then the vision dapat one year and then right now 24-20 na [ang vision] ko,” said Lawrence in a separate interview.Daddy Gerry, meanwhile, admitted that their family still misses “everything” about AJ.“[We miss] his face, his smile…” he added pensively.Prior to AJ, actors Miko Sotto, Angelo Manhilot and Edward James Lim—sons of Ali Sotto, Cesar Montano and Toni Rose Gayda, respectively—donated their corneas to the Eye Bank.
